    Roger Federer’s appointment as the honorary starter for the 2025 Le Mans 24 Hours introduces a prominent figure to this year's celebrated endurance race, scheduled for June 14-15 at the Circuit de la Sarthe. Known for his remarkable achievements in tennis, including 20 Grand Slam titles, Federer acknowledged the demanding nature of the race, emphasizing the commitment and precision required from participants. His involvement is expected to enhance the event's appeal, drawing a sellout crowd and generating significant interest beyond the motorsport community.

    Pierre Fillon, president of the Automobile Club de l’Ouest, highlighted Federer’s legendary status and the positive impact he brings to the race. This appointment follows the precedent set by soccer star Zinedine Zidane, who previously served in the same role. Federer expressed excitement about participating in such a challenging event, signaling a unique experience that combines sporting prowess with the rich heritage of the 24 Hours of Le Mans. His role as starter not only adds star power to the race but also reinforces its status as a hallmark of endurance racing excellence.
